What is a senior logistics project manager?

Senior Logistics Project Managers are experienced professionals who oversee and coordinate complex logistics projects within an organization. They are responsible for planning, implementing, and monitoring supply chain operations to ensure the efficient movement of goods and materials. Their role often involves managing teams, optimizing processes, handling budgets, and collaborating with various departments to meet project goals on time and within budget. They also analyze logistics data, identify areas for improvement, and implement best practices to enhance overall efficiency. Strong leadership, organizational, and problem-solving skills are ess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ior logistics project manager?

A Senior Logistics Project Manager typically requires expertise in supply chain management, project planning, and analytical problem-solving, supported by a relevant degree and extensive experience in logistics or operations. Familiarity with ERP systems like SAP, project management tools such as MS Project, and certifications like PMP or Six Sigma are highly valued. Strong leadership, excellent communication, and the ability to manage cross-functional teams are crucial soft skills for this role. These abilities ensure efficient project delivery, cost control, and seamless coordination across complex logistics networks.

How do senior logistics project managers typically coll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ure project success?

Senior Logistics Project Managers regularly work with cross-functional teams—including procurement, operations, IT, and supply chain partners—to align project goals and resolve challenges. They often lead project meetings, set clear communication protocols, and ensure all stakeholders are informed about timelines and deliverables. Effective collaboration is essential, as logistics projects often depend on input and coordination across multiple departments. By fostering strong relationships and encouraging proactive problem-solving, Senior Logistics Project Managers help keep projects on track and drive continuous improvement.

What is the difference between Senior Logistics Project Manager vs Logistics Coordinator?

AspectSenior Logistics Project ManagerLogistics Coordinator
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in logistics, supply chain, or related field; PMP or similar certifications often preferredHigh school diploma or associate degree; certifications like CCLP beneficial
Work EnvironmentOversees multiple projects, manages teams, and interacts with senior managementSupports daily logistics operations, coordinates shipments, and communicates with vendors
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in manufacturing, retail, and distribution companies for project oversightCommon in warehousing, transportation, and distribution centers for operational support

The main difference is that a Senior Logistics Project Manager focuses on managing complex logistics projects and leading teams, while a Logistics Coordinator handles daily operational tasks and supports logistics activities. The senior role involves strategic planning and higher-level decision-making, whereas the coordinator role is more execution-focused.

We are seeking an experienced Project Manager – Logistics to support a large-scale, mission-critical data center construction program in Northern Indiana. This role will be responsible for managing site logistics planning and execution, ensuring efficient coordination of materials, deliveries, laydown areas, equipment movement, and overall site flow across a complex multi-contractor environment.

The ideal candidate will have strong experience in construction logistics on large commercial, industrial, or mission-critical projects and the ability to coordinate multiple trades, vendors, and site teams in a fast-paced construction setting.

Responsibilities
  • Develop and manage the overall site logistics plan from preconstruction through project completion
  • Coordinate delivery schedules, material staging, laydown areas, and site access routes
  • Oversee movement of materials, equipment, and personnel across a high-activity construction site
  • Work closely with superintendents, project managers, and subcontractors to align logistics with construction sequencing
  • Manage crane picks, hoisting plans, and major equipment deliveries
  • Coordinate traffic management, site security access, and vendor logistics requirements
  • Ensure efficient use of laydown space and site infrastructure
  • Track and resolve delivery conflicts, access constraints, and material delays
  • Support scheduling alignment between logistics activities and project milestones
  • Liaise with vendors, suppliers, and logistics providers to ensure timely deliveries
  • Maintain logistics plans, drawings, and tracking documentation
  • Ensure compliance with safety standards across all logistics operations
Qualifications
  • 5–10+ years of experience in construction logistics, project management, or site operations
  • Strong background in large commercial, industrial, or mission-critical construction projects
  • Experience managing complex logistics on multi-trade, high-density construction sites
  • Strong understanding of construction sequencing, material flow, and site coordination
  • Ability to manage crane operations, deliveries, and heavy equipment logistics
  • Excellent communication, coordination, and problem-solving skills
  • Experience working with general contractors, trade partners, and suppliers in fast-paced environments
  • Familiarity with data center, manufacturing, or infrastructure projects preferred
  • OSHA 30 certification preferred
  • Degree in Construction Management, Engineering, or related field preferred
